WebJan 1, 2024 · Among U.S. states, Georgia’s tax system ranks close to the middle of the pack for the burden its tax system places on taxpayers. Combined state and local sales taxes in the Peach State average 7.37%. The state’s top marginal income tax rate of 5.75%. Likewise, its average property taxes are near the national averages. If your salary is £22,000, then after tax and national insurance you will be left with £ 18,864 . This means that after tax you will take home £1,572 every month, or £ 363 per week, £ 72.60 per day, and your hourly rate will be £ 10.58 if you're working 40 hours/week.
